Mark 6:2

And when the sabbath day was come, he began to teach in the synagogue: and many hearing him were astonished, saying, From whence hath this man these things? and what wisdom is this which is given unto him, that even such mighty works are wrought by his hands?

KJV

καὶ γενομένου σαββάτου ἤρξατο διδάσκειν ἐν τῇ συναγωγῇ· καὶ οἱ πολλοὶ ἀκούοντες ἐξεπλήσσοντο, λέγοντες· πόθεν τούτῳ ταῦτα, καὶ τίς ἡ σοφία ἡ δοθεῖσα τούτῳ; καὶ δυνάμεις τοιαῦται διὰ τῶν χειρῶν αὐτοῦ γίνονται;

Greek NT

et facto sabbato cœpit in synagoga docere : et multi audientes admirabantur in doctrina ejus, dicentes : Unde huic hæc omnia ? et quæ est sapientia, quæ data est illi, et virtutes tales, quæ per manus ejus efficiuntur ?

Vulgate

And when the sabbath was come, he began to teach in the synagogue: and many hearing him were astonished, saying, Whence hath this man these things? and, What is the wisdom that is given unto this man, and what mean such mighty works wrought by his hands?

ASV

And when the Sabbath was come, he began to teach in the synagogue: and many hearing him were in admiration at his doctrine, saying: How came this man by all these things? and what wisdom is this that is given to him, and such mighty works as are wrought by his hands?

Douay-Rheims

Textual variants

5 variant units attested by manuscript witnesses and modern critical editions.

minor
SBLGNT: διδάσκειν ἐν τῇ συναγωγῇ | WH/Treg/NIV: διδάσκειν ἐν τῇ συναγωγῇ | RP: ἐν τῇ συναγωγῇ διδάσκειν
  • διδάσκειν ἐν τῇ συναγωγῇSBLGNT
  • διδάσκειν ἐν τῇ συναγωγῇWestcott-Hort, Tregelles, Reader's GNT (NA27)
  • ἐν τῇ συναγωγῇ διδάσκεινRobinson-Pierpont
source: sblgnt-apparatus
trivial
SBLGNT: οἱ | WH: οἱ
  • οἱSBLGNT
  • οἱWestcott-Hort
source: sblgnt-apparatus
minor
SBLGNT: τούτῳ | WH/Treg/NIV: τούτῳ | RP: αὐτῷ
  • τούτῳSBLGNT
  • τούτῳWestcott-Hort, Tregelles, Reader's GNT (NA27)
  • αὐτῷRobinson-Pierpont
source: sblgnt-apparatus
trivial
SBLGNT: αἱ | WH/NIV: αἱ
  • αἱSBLGNT
  • αἱWestcott-Hort, Reader's GNT (NA27)
source: sblgnt-apparatus
minor
SBLGNT: γινόμεναι | WH/Treg/NIV: γινόμεναι | RP: γίνονται
  • γινόμεναιSBLGNT
  • γινόμεναιWestcott-Hort, Tregelles, Reader's GNT (NA27)
  • γίνονταιRobinson-Pierpont
source: sblgnt-apparatus
